Prothonotary Warbler In Oaks and Prairies

Prothonotary Warbler in Oaks and Prairies has surged: up 99% on the route-weighted index since 1969.

Forecast

If the recent trend holds, Prothonotary Warbler in Oaks and Prairies is projected to fall about 15% by 2029 — from 0.15 in 2024 to a central estimate of 0.13 (95% range 0.04–0.21). A 5-year backtest shows a typical error of ±99.9%, with 100% of held-out values landing inside the 95% band.
